5/28/25 | Former Rangers Reliever Seeking Absurd Salary to Return to Baseball. The Texas Rangers re-worked their bullpen this past offseason and in doing so, let a prolific reliever walk in free agency. David Robertson — who was a quality set-up man for the Rangers a year ago — is still waiting for someone to sign him. Given his contract demands, he probably won't be returning to Texas. USA Today's Bob Nightengale recently reported that 16-year MLB veteran David Robertson told interested teams that he was looking for a one-year, $15 million deal and won't be signing a contract until he "receives a strong offer." 5/21/25 | NL East rival considering reunion with ex-Mets reliever. Former New York Mets reliever David Robertson remains unsigned through mid-May, but it appears an NL East rival has the veteran right-hander on its radar. According to MLB.com's Mark Feinsand, the Philadelphia Phillies reached out to Robertson before the announcement of high-leverage reliever José Alvarado's 80-game suspension.
